## Job Opportunity: Machine Operator in Steel Processing Industry

Our client, a leading company in the steel processing industry, is seeking a skilled machine operator to ensure the safe and efficient movement of heavy materials. If you are detail-oriented, physically fit, and have experience operating gantry cranes, this role could be a perfect fit for you.

### Key Responsibilities: - **Operate Gantry Cranes**: Safely and efficiently move, lift, and position heavy loads using gantry cranes. - **Load and Unload Materials**: Assist in loading and unloading materials, ensuring proper handling to prevent damage. - **Conduct Inspections**: Perform daily inspections of the crane, report maintenance needs, and malfunctions. - **Follow Safety Protocols**: Adhere to all safety guidelines to maintain a secure working environment. - **Collaborate with Team Members**: Work closely with ground personnel and team members for smooth operations. - **Maintain Records**: Keep accurate records of operations, maintenance activities, and incidents. - **Communication**: Coordinate with team members using communication devices for efficient workflow.

### Candidate Requirements: - **Detail-Oriented**: High attention to detail and accuracy in tasks. - **Licenses**: Forklift license and a full Class 1 driver’s license required. - **Dependability**: Reliable, punctual, and committed to work. - **Physical Fitness**: Capable of meeting the physical demands of the job. - **Experience**: Previous experience operating gantry cranes is preferred. - **Willingness to Learn**: Open to training and development, including operating CNC plasma and laser machines.
